vscode添加Git仓库与使用步骤

317 阅读2分钟

添加Git仓库与使用步骤

1、Git(全局配置)链接gitee账号

bash窗口中:

git config --global user.name "骆莹莹"
​
git config --global user.email "2692632511@qq.com"
​
ssh-keygen -t rsa -C "2692632511@qq.com"
​
cat ~/.ssh/id_rsa.pub

去gitee设置中添加公钥

2、创建代码仓库并拉取/添加远程存储库

(1)gitee中创建仓库(修改了默认分支为main),vscode中直接拉取
(2)添加远程存储库:
1)vscode中初始默认在main分支上操作
//初始化仓库(也可直接页面ui进行操作)
git init//添加到git暂存区(跟踪文件更改的中间区域)
git add README.md  
​
//创建并切换到master分支工作
git checkout -b master  
​
//将暂存区中的文件提交到本地的Git仓库master分支,之后才能设置上游分支   
git commit -m "Initial commit on master branch"//链接远程存储库
git remote add origin https://gitee.com/luo-ying-ying/easyChat.git //确保本地分支与远程分支同步
git fetch
​
//当拉取(git pull)并合并到本地分支时,本地分支和远程分支没有共享提交历史,强制Git合并
git pull --tags --allow-unrelated-histories origin master
​
//查看远程分支
git ls-remote --heads origin    
​
//将本地master上游设置为远程的master
git branch --set-upstream-to=origin/master
​
//检查当前分支跟踪的远程分支(推送目标)
git branch -vv
(返回branch '* master d4225dc [origin/master: ahead 1, behind 1] Initial commit on master branch即设置成功)
2)若远程默认分支为main(受保护)

可根据以下命令修改,也可直接在gitee中仓库设置修改默认分支

//检查当前分支跟踪的远程分支(推送目标)
git branch -vv  
​
//停止跟踪远程的 `main` (默认)分支
git branch --unset-upstream    
​
//设置本地master分支跟踪远程master分支
git branch -u origin/master
(返回branch 'master' set up to track 'origin/master'.即设置成功)

后续操作都可以直接从vscode界面进行

3、补充:Git提交信息规范

feat/feature:新增功能

fix:修复bug

style:代码风格调整

docs:文档更新

test:测试相关

refactor:代码重构

chore:杂务或日常事务